    1. What are some of the main drivers of the increasing necessity for HR support?

    In our experience many businesses:

    • Have identified a need for legal guidance and HR support to help them successfully navigate an increasingly complex legal landscape 
    • Are seeking better cost management and operational efficiencies and require HR support with this, for example changing employees’ terms and conditions, implementing a restructure / redundancy process
    • Are becoming more focused on effective general staff management with a view to both protecting their business from employment tribunal claims and driving forward success
    • Are placing employee wellbeing issues high on the agenda to tackle concerns such as staff retention and motivation 

    In addition to the current challenges facing businesses, the Employment Rights Bill is also understandably causing concern. As the Bill progresses, and government consultations are undertaken, keeping up to date with developments will be a must for all businesses.
